Output 66be078ab06b86dd63ce3e6ae54e7157c53e7e20904aa9a37ff33e238df504e7:10

value
5619032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 994795855066bf7de80256ea38319ae8a2813dff OP_EQUAL
address
3FfV4eBWa8DNogRuiWEqjGNdTVwGtDjpcQ
transaction
66be078ab06b86dd63ce3e6ae54e7157c53e7e20904aa9a37ff33e238df504e7
spent
true